A prominent football club in Birmingham is looking for a Digital Product Marketing Executive to enhance and optimize its digital platforms, including website, mobile app, and ticketing services. The role involves collaborating with teams to improve user experience and engagement.
Candidates should have experience in digital product roles, strong analytical skills, and a passion for sports along with the ability to work proactively in a fast-paced environ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Birmingham City FC
✨Know Your Digital Products
Before the interview, dive deep into the club's digital platforms. Familiarise yourself with their website, mobile app, and ticketing services. Be ready to discuss what you think works well and what could be improved, showing your analytical skills and passion for enhancing user experience.
✨Show Your Sports Passion
Make sure to express your love for sports during the interview. Share personal experiences or insights related to football that demonstrate your enthusiasm. This will help you connect with the interviewers and show that you're not just a candidate, but a fan who understands the audience.
✨Prepare for Collaboration Questions
Since the role involves working with various teams, be prepared to discuss your past collaborative experiences. Think of specific examples where you successfully worked with others to achieve a common goal, especially in fast-paced environments. This will highlight your proactive nature and teamwork skills.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t shy away from asking questions. Inquire about the club's future digital initiatives or how they measure user engagement.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you understand how you can contribute to their goals.
